用Vibe Coding重新定义心理健康应用的未来

最近在研究心理健康类App时,我发现了一个有趣的现象:市面上的应用虽然数量众多,但真正能持续帮助用户的却不多。作为一个Vibe Coding的实践者,我不禁开始思考:如果采用氛围编程的方式来构建这类应用,会带来怎样的改变?

在传统的开发模式中,心理健康App往往是一次性开发完成的产品。开发者根据调研设计功能,用户被动接受。但问题是,每个人的心理状态都是动态变化的,固定的功能很难满足这种流动的需求。这就好比给所有人开同一副药方,效果自然有限。

而Vibe Coding的核心思想——代码是能力,意图与接口才是长期资产——在这里就显得格外重要。想象一下,我们不再纠结于具体的代码实现,而是专注于定义清晰的意图:”当用户感到焦虑时,提供合适的缓解方案”、”在用户情绪低落时,给予正向引导”。这些意图描述才是真正有价值的资产。

让我用一个具体的例子来说明。假设我们要开发一个焦虑管理功能。在Vibe Coding模式下,我们会这样描述意图:”根据用户的实时心率数据、自述情绪状态和历史应对效果,从呼吸练习、认知重构、身体放松三个维度提供个性化建议。每次干预后记录效果,持续优化建议策略。”

这个意图描述包含了几个关键要素:明确的数据输入(心率、自述情绪)、清晰的能力范围(三个干预维度)、持续优化的机制。AI会根据这个意图动态组装代码,生成最适合当前用户的干预方案。更重要的是,随着使用数据的积累,系统会不断优化自己的响应策略。

这里就体现了Vibe Coding的另一条原则:一切皆数据。用户的情绪数据、干预记录、效果反馈,甚至是系统生成的临时代码,都需要统一管理。这样做不仅能保证干预的连续性,还能在必要时追溯每个决策的依据。

我特别欣赏”避免数据删除”这个原则在心理健康领域的应用价值。想象一下,如果用户的心理状态变化轨迹被完整保留,治疗师就能更准确地把握用户的心理变化规律。当然,这需要在严格保护隐私的前提下进行。

在实际开发中,我们可以采用”用标准连接一切能力”的思路。比如,定义一个标准的情绪评估接口,让不同的干预模块都能基于相同的数据标准工作。这样,当新的干预方法出现时,就能快速集成到系统中。

不过,Vibe Coding在心理健康领域的应用也面临挑战。最大的问题是如何确保AI组装的干预方案是安全有效的。这就需要我们建立严格的验证机制——这正是”验证与观测是系统成功的核心”原则的用武之地。每个干预方案都需要经过多重测试,确保其符合专业标准。

让我分享一个正在进行的实验项目。我们尝试用Vibe Coding方法构建一个轻度的情绪支持系统。用户只需要描述自己的感受,系统就会动态组装合适的支持方案。有时候是一段引导冥想,有时候是一系列认知练习,有时候只是简单的陪伴对话。令人惊喜的是,用户反馈这种”量身定制”的体验比固定功能的应用更有帮助。

这个实验也验证了”人人编程,专业治理”的可能性。心理专业工作者不需要懂编程,他们只需要用专业语言描述干预意图,系统就能将其转化为可执行的能力单元。而技术人员则专注于确保系统的安全性、稳定性和合规性。

展望未来,我认为Vibe Coding将推动心理健康服务从”产品”向”生态”转变。不同的服务提供者可以基于统一的标准开发能力单元,用户获得的是真正个性化、持续优化的服务。这不仅仅是技术的进步,更是服务模式的革新。

当然,这条路还很长。我们需要解决数据隐私、专业认证、责任界定等诸多问题。但每当我看到用户因为一个恰到好处的干预而露出笑容时,我就坚信这个方向值得探索。毕竟,在关爱心理健康这件事上,我们需要的不是更多的App,而是更智能、更贴心的支持。

你觉得呢?当技术真正理解人的情感需求时,会创造出怎样的可能性?